I am doing my brakes and found the rubber bushings worn on the shock links. Getting the shock links is no problem , however how the heck do you remove the shock link studs? Any ideas are most appreciated

If you are talking about the rear shock links, which I assume you are, the studs are pressed into the shock link and come already pressed onto the new shock links.

I am not sure I made myself clear in my last post.. You need to buy the shock links complete with the studs already pressed in...They run about $100.00 per pair and I believe All Cads carries them maybe other too but I can't think of whom or is it who?

Herman, I was talking about removing the shock link stud from the axle housing , which is also pressed in. Anyway I got them out . I used pb blaster and a 12 lbs hammer and beat them out.
